EVT_UFX_DEVICE_PROPRIETARY_CHARGER_RESET Rückruffunktion (ufxclient.h)
Die Implementierung des Clienttreibers zum Zurücksetzen des proprietären Ladegeräts.
Syntax
EVT_UFX_DEVICE_PROPRIETARY_CHARGER_RESET EvtUfxDeviceProprietaryChargerReset;
void EvtUfxDeviceProprietaryChargerReset(
[in] UFXDEVICE unnamedParam1
)
{...}
Parameter
[in] unnamedParam1
Das Handle für ein USB-Geräteobjekt, das der Clienttreiber bei einem vorherigen Aufruf der UfxDeviceCreate-Methode empfangen hat.
Rückgabewert
Keine
Bemerkungen
EVT_UFX_DEVICE_PROPRIETARY_CHARGER_RESET ist ein optionaler Ereignisrückruf.
Die USB-Funktionsklassenerweiterung (UFX) ruft diesen Ereignisrückruf auf, um anzugeben, dass das USB-Gerät vom Ladegerät getrennt wurde. Der Clienttreiber initiiert eine Anforderung an den unteren Filtertreiber, um den ursprünglichen Zustand des proprietären Ladegeräts zurückzusetzen.
Anforderungen
Anforderung | Wert |
---|---|
Zielplattform | Windows |
KMDF-Mindestversion | 1.0 |
UMDF-Mindestversion | 2.0 |
Kopfzeile | ufxclient.h |
IRQL | PASSIVE_LEVEL |